Abstract
ENGLISH ABSTRACT: This thesis presents a novel method of parametrization and optimization for a large design space exploration of a micro gas turbine compressor stage. 48 free parameters were used to control the meridional channel, blade camber, and structural geometric features. The optimization focused on determining the optimal impeller meridional discharge (mixed flow) angle, αz2, for a predetermined set of constraints. The influence of key geometric features on design performance was assessed using a Pearson correlation coefficient (rp) map. Stage total-to-static pressure ratio, PR(01−4),DP , and efficiency, η(01−4),DP, were strongly influenced (| rp |> 0,4) by diffuser outlet passage height and diffuser vane wrap angle. This was due to their control of flow separation magnitude at the diffuser hub in the radial-to-axial bend. A multidisciplinary workflow was scripted to incorporate the CalculiX CrunchiX structural analysis into the NUMECA FINETM/Design3D aerodynamic optimization package. Structural feasibility constraints were placed on maximum von Mises stress, blade tip displacement, and resonance frequencies of the impeller. A three-dimensional Pareto front was constructed to assist in selection of the final design. The final design achieved a PR(01−4),DP of 4,15 and η(01−4),DP of 86,24%, at a design mass flow rate of 1,089 kg/s. Choke and stall margins of 7,4% and 11,8% were achieved at the design speed of 73 000 RPM.
